These look excellent. When it comes to connecting your lines, the way you have done it is fine for this assignment. Try keeping your lines a bit lighter as you lay them in and then slowing down to add a darker line in the areas where your lines connect. I personally think your lines have really nice energy. For this type of drawing you won’t get perfect proportions so don’t stress about it too much. These are very successful, nice work!

I think you are on the right track. You're doing a great job implementing CSI lines and you have a good understanding of gesture. At the risk of sounding cliche, keep practicing this skill. You seem to be at the stage where getting the mileage is going to benefit you the most. I think it's a good idea to keep a small sketchbook at all times and draw shapes from life if you can. Practice drawing dynamic shapes from imagination as well. You can draw seals or anything else that you find enjoyable to draw. Keep up the good work 👍
